EMS vs DHL vs YunExpress for Reps: 2026 Carrier Comparison

Side-by-side EMS, DHL, and YunExpress for rep shipments. Transit times, cost curves, customs behavior across US, UK, EU, AU.

Three carriers handle 80%+ of rep shipments from China to Western markets: EMS (postal, cheapest), DHL (express, premium), and YunExpress (mid-tier). Which is right for your parcel depends on destination, value, and timing.

Headline comparison

FactorEMSDHLYunExpress
Cost (3kg to US)$75$145$90
Transit (US)14-21d7-10d10-16d
Transit (UK)14-21d6-10d10-14d
Transit (EU)16-24d8-12d12-18d
Transit (AU)18-26d9-14d14-20d
Customs reliabilityMediumHighMedium
Damage rate~0.5%~0.1%~0.4%
Lost rate~0.3%~0.05%~0.2%

When to use each carrier

Use EMS when…

  • Parcel value under $150
  • Delivery date isn't urgent
  • Destination is a major city with active postal network
  • Total parcel weight is 2-5kg (EMS's sweet spot)

Use DHL when…

  • Parcel value over $300
  • You need predictable transit
  • Destination is EU or AU (DHL DDP simplifies customs)
  • Sensitive items (watches, leather bags)

Use YunExpress when…

  • Parcel value $150-300
  • You want cost-time balance
  • Destination has good YunExpress infrastructure (US, UK)
  • You've verified the carrier handles your specific country well

Weight-cost curves

For DHL, cost is roughly linear per kg above 500g. For EMS, price breaks happen at 2kg, 5kg, 10kg (cheaper per kg at higher weight). YunExpress is most linear but with volumetric-weight discount on large dimension items.

Typical break points (to US):

WeightEMSDHLYunExpress
1kg$45$100$55
3kg$75$145$90
5kg$105$190$125
10kg$180$310$205

For 10kg+ parcels, consider sea-air hybrid lines (SEA Express) — cheaper than any of these three above 10kg.

Customs treatment per carrier

EMS → USPS (US) / Royal Mail (UK) / etc.

Postal handoff. Customs interacts with postal inbound queue. Hold rates are highest on EMS due to less pre-clearance.

DHL → direct delivery

Private courier. DHL handles customs-to-delivery without postal handoff. Lowest hold rates, most predictable.

YunExpress → USPS (US) / Royal Mail / etc.

Similar to EMS with better tracking. Occasional hold but generally smoother.

Damage and loss

DHL has the lowest damage rate (~0.1%) and the lowest loss rate (~0.05%). For $500+ parcels, DHL's reliability advantage is worth the premium.

EMS and YunExpress have comparable damage/loss rates; neither is catastrophically unsafe, but both are less reliable than DHL.

Insurance

  • DHL: included up to $100 typically; higher coverage via paid add- on
  • YunExpress: included up to $50; paid coverage available
  • EMS: included up to ~$90; additional coverage in some destinations

For parcels over $300 declared, paid insurance is cheap ($5-10) and worth it regardless of carrier.
